Argus Research Slashes Air Products and Chemicals, Inc. (APD)’s Price Target To $265, Maintains Buy Rating

Air Products and Chemicals, Inc. (NYSE:APD) is among the 11 Most Oversold S&P 500 Stocks Heading into 2026. On December 11, Argus Research lowered its price target on the stock to $265 from $317, while maintaining a Buy rating on the shares.

In a research note to investors, the analyst mentioned ongoing macroeconomic headwinds from soft demand and high input costs, but added that the situation is likely to ease in 2026. Despite the challenging environment, Argus expects improvements in EBITDA and revenue ahead.

On the same day, UBS downgraded Air Products and Chemicals, Inc. (NYSE:APD)’s rating to Neutral from Buy, and slashed its price target down from $310 to $250. The analyst noted the recent decline in share price following the company’s updates on the Louisiana and NEOM projects.

While UBS feels the plunge could be an overreaction, the firm believes that earnings growth over the medium term could fall below prior expectations. Moreover, it also sees a slower path to free cash flow improvement for the company.

In other news, on December 10, Deutsche Bank also cut its price target on Air Products and Chemicals, Inc. (NYSE:APD) to $255 from $285. However, it reiterated a Hold rating on the shares.

Despite recent analyst updates, Wall Street analysts have a consensus Moderate Buy rating on the stock, with a one-year average share price target of $304.19, implying a 25% upside.

Air Products and Chemicals, Inc. (NYSE:APD) is an industrial gases company that serves the energy, environmental, and emerging markets. The stock has had a challenging 2025 and is down 16% year-to-date.
